Abstract

The invention belongs to the technical field of building construction, and relates to a rotary building structure comprising a framework, a bottom layer unit, and a plurality of upper layer units. The framework comprises a plurality of upright columns, a bottom support frame and a plurality of upper support frames. The bottom support frame and the upper support frames are respectively provided with a plurality of rollers and a combination of a plurality of drive gears and drive devices along their circumferential directions. The bottom layer unit and the upper layer units comprise a circular house base plate and a circular house roof plate; the house base plate and the house roof plate are horizontally and coaxially arranged, with the house base plate being under the house roof plate; both the house base plate and the house roof plate are connected by walls and a plurality of rooms are divided by the walls therebetween. The wall of a room far away from the center is provided with a window. The wall of the bottom layer unit far away from the center is provided with a stair door. An annular rail is arranged below the house base plate. The house base plate is put on the rollers through the rail. The entire bottom layer unit or the upper layer units can rotate on the rollers. A driven gear which is engaged with the drive gears is arranged below the house base plate. By using the rotary building structure, the whole scenic region can be seen, and the orientations of the windows can be selected at will.
